Study Summary
The purpose of this post approval study is to evaluate the long-term safety of the FDA approved St. Jude Medical Tendril MRI™ lead implanted with a SJM Brady MRI implantable pulse generator (IPG) such as the Accent MRI™, Assurity MRI™, Endurity MRI™ pacemaker, or similar model (SJM Brady MRI System) in subjects with a standard bradycardia pacing indication.
